Career Role (Chemoinformatics & Electrochemistry) Description
Computational Electrochemist Develops and applies computational methods to study electrochemical systems, focusing on molecular simulations and data analysis. High demand in battery technology and materials science.
Chemoinformatics Analyst (Electrochemical Applications) Analyzes large datasets related to electrochemical processes, using chemoinformatics techniques to identify trends, predict properties, and optimize designs. Crucial role in drug discovery and materials development.
Electrochemical Data Scientist Applies advanced statistical methods and machine learning to electrochemical data, building predictive models and supporting decision-making across various industry sectors. Strong demand in energy storage and environmental remediation.
Senior Research Scientist (Chemoinformatics & Electrochemistry) Leads research projects focusing on the interface of chemoinformatics and electrochemistry, mentors junior scientists, and publishes findings in high-impact journals. Requires extensive experience and expertise in both fields.

A Professional Certificate in Chemoinformatics for Electrochemistry equips participants with the skills to apply computational methods to electrochemical problems. The program focuses on bridging the gap between chemical intuition and data-driven analysis, crucial for modern electrochemical research and development.


Learning outcomes typically include mastering cheminformatics software, performing molecular simulations relevant to electrochemical systems (like batteries and fuel cells), and interpreting complex datasets to optimize electrochemical processes. Students gain proficiency in predictive modeling, a vital skill in materials science and electrocatalysis.
